当前位置:首页 > 科技动态 > 正文

c语言如何去掉最后的空格

c语言如何去掉最后的空格

在C语言中,去除字符串末尾的空格可以通过编写一个函数来实现,该函数会遍历字符串,从尾部开始向前检查,直到遇到非空格字符为止。以下是一个简单的示例函数,它接受一个字符串参...

在C语言中,去除字符串末尾的空格可以通过编写一个函数来实现,该函数会遍历字符串,从尾部开始向前检查,直到遇到非空格字符为止。以下是一个简单的示例函数,它接受一个字符串参数,并去除该字符串末尾的所有空格:

```c

include

include

void trimTrailingSpaces(char str) {

int len = strlen(str);

if (len == 0) return;

// 从字符串末尾开始向前查找非空格字符

while (len > 0 && str[len 1] == ' ') {

len--;

最新文章